Amicus curiae report on Padmanabha Swamy temple 'disturbing': SC

New Delhi, April 23: The amicus curiae report on the Padmanabha Swamy temple is 'disturbing', said the Supreme Court on Wednesday.

The report highlighted alleged 'mismanagements' in the temple, which is administered by the Travancore royal family. It was in 2011, a massive treasure trove was found in the underground vaults of the 16th century temple. The treasure found in five vaults has been estimated at over Rs.1 lakh crore. one vault is yet to be opened.

The amicus curiae report had said that the apex court has to intervene in the affairs of the temple for 'transparency and probity'. "Auditors of the temple have failed in performing their ethical and professional duties. There is failure to account effectively for the offerings in cash, currency, gold and silver", said the report.

Reportedly, the amicus curiae had found a massive gold pilferage from the temple.
